The advancement of membrane technology as a sustainable and competitive separation process necessitates achieving a significantly higher specificity, rapid transport, and scalability. Our research focuses on the design of polymeric materials for multilayer membranes through the crosslinking and interfacial polymerization of macrocycles and other selected segments, specifically for the separation of small molecules and ions in the chemical and pharmaceutical industries and for the harvesting elements from complex mixtures. For macromolecular separation, we develop mesoporous membranes via the controlled phase separation of polymers and copolymer solutions. The talk will review the latest developments from our group, including advanced methods for characterizing porosity.
